Jennifer Davidson
banner
jenniferdavidson.bsky.social
Jennifer Davidson
@jenniferdavidson.bsky.social
Screenwriter, Cat Mama, Chair Writers Guild of Ireland, Culchie, generally making things up for a living.
No videos yet.